South Staffordshire Council honours the fallen on Remembrance Day
________________________________________
________________________________________
On Remembrance Day, South Staffordshire Council came together to reflect on the courage and sacrifice of the military personnel who gave their lives in service to our country.
In a moving ceremony, we honoured the bravery and resilience of those who served and continue to serve.
The service was led by Reverend Philip Wootton and included a parade by the Royal British Legion, culminating in a two-minute silence observed at 11am.
The event was attended by the Chairman and Leader of the Council, MP Mike Wood, Sir Gavin Williamson’s representative Ryan Hillback, local dignitaries, council officers, and pupils from local schools.
Wreaths were laid in tribute, beginning with the Chairman of the Council, followed by other dignitaries and community representatives.
We thank everyone who joined us in paying tribute to our fallen heroes.
Their courage, dedication, and sacrifice will never be forgotten.

Cost of living support this winter
________________________________________
South Staffordshire welfare services team have been supporting residents with cost of living and eating well as we enter the winter months.
Local community groups and welcome hubs have been identifying residents who are living on their own, isolated and/or on a low income and would benefit from a slow cooker.
Over 100 cookers have now been distributed across the district including Essington, Cheslyn Hay, Bilbrook, Penkridge, Huntington, and Codsall.
Beneficiaries have also included families relying on food banks this winter and those with health concerns.
Councillor Gary Burnett, Bilbrook stated “The scheme has proved extremely popular. Slow cookers are great for residents of pension age, especially if they are living alone, because they can prepare nutritious meals with minimal effort and save on energy costs”.
Councillor Megan Barrow, Cabinet member for Welfare Services, shared “those vulnerable, isolated residents, and families using local food banks, are all benefiting from this project.
St Nicholas CE First School are also loving the way these community projects are including their organisations and supporting their pupils and families.”

Gym changing room refurbishment at Wombourne Leisure Centre
________________________________________
Wombourne Leisure Centre’s gym changing rooms will be undergoing a full refurbishment starting Monday, 17th November.
The works are expected to take around four weeks, with completion before Christmas.
What’s happening?
• Full refurbishment of both male and female gym changing rooms
• Upgrades include new flooring, benches, vanity areas, toilets, showers, lockers, and redecoration
What you need to know:
• Both changing rooms will be closed from Monday, 17th November
• Early gym users (before 8.30am) can use pool changing rooms and lockers
• Between 8.30am-3.30pm, no alternative changing areas are available due to safeguarding and school use
• Evening users: please arrive gym-ready and change and shower at home
• No lockers or storage available – bring minimal belongings and no valuables
• Toilets near the gym corridor remain accessible
• No drinks fountains – please bring your own or use vending machines
We apologise for the inconvenience and appreciate your cooperation. We’re confident the new facilities will be worth the wait!

South Staffordshire Community Safety Partnership (CSP) works to ensure that South Staffordshire is a safe place to live, work and visit.
We want to hear your perception of crime in your local area, your opinion on the priorities in the 2025-26 Community Safety Partnership Plan and your thoughts on other areas the partnership should consider.
The closing date of the survey is Friday, 21st November.
